| OpenMV, the "Arduino of machine vision," combines MicroPython firmware, easy-to-use libraries, a custom IDE, and specialized camera hardware...
| OpenMV, the "Arduino of machine vision," combines MicroPython firmware, easy-to-use libraries, a custom IDE, and specialized camera hardware...
| Watch how Ada, Spark, and Rust are shaping the future of safe, high-performance embedded software in this in-depth conversation with Quentin...
| AI is transforming how we design electronics, but it’s not here to replace engineers. It’s here to create a new kind of engineer, one who bu...
| Embedded software is becoming too complex for traditional testing. Formal methods offer a mathematically proven way to ensure code is secure...
| Debugging firmware after deployment can be a nightmare. But what if you could catch errors before your code runs? This article explores Test...
| Large language models can accelerate your software development. In this tutorial, we use the Continue extension for Visual Studio Code and e...
| We’ve mistaken complexity for progress — and forgotten how things really work. A 41-year-old home computer still boots instantly, while toda...
| Want to get started with the A121 radar sensor from Acconeer? It is a powerful but not so easy-to-master sensor. In this article, we cover b...
| A UK–Netherlands project is pioneering "Conversational Prototyping," using Large Language Models to design complex hardware architectures an...
| The analog input of an Espressif ESP32 doesn't seem very reactive in the very first part of its allowed range, with a lack of response, and...